I’m just back from a residential trip with 20 of our KS3 GLD learners. Hard work, but fun.
I experimented with using a blog to compliment the usual diary work. Our children have limited literacy and the use of images and movies is invaluable. I chose to create a blog on blogger.com. It was essential to password protect the blog to protect the identity of many of our children. Blogger.com allows just that.
It proved to be a fantastic shared space where the children could share their experiences and ask each other questions. Most definitely a proof of concept. I will certainly develop the idea for future residentials. I am also looking forward to creating a shared blog between our partner school in Ghana, New Horizons Special School and ourselves.
